In this position, the candidate will be involved in various stages of the power use case modeling, analysis, correlation, and improvement cycles. Skills/experience: • Recent and relevant experience required in one or more of the following areas: o Application processor o Modem Communication systems design o Experience in mobile technologies areas (e.g., WAN modem, CPU, camera, , graphics,) o Experience in commercialization of System-level power features is required, and an interest in System and analysis is a must. o Solid foundation in Electrical Engineering, with the ability to work with spreadsheets and other custom tools at a detailed level. Other Professional Attributes and Desired Skills: o Systems/HW background with a good understanding of microprocessor and common SoC hardware blocks (Interconnects, Display, Graphics, etc.) Responsibilities: The candidate is responsible for: • Maintaining and developing chipset level power use case modeling tools and methodologies. • Working with the power HW/SW/System teams to collect power use case definition and characteristics. • Understanding the hardware architecture/design at a high level and how the power use cases exercise and map to individual HW blocks. • Translating the power estimate requests into detailed tasks for end-to-end use case power modeling Analyzing the modeling output, summarizing the results, presenting, and proposing the improvement solutions. • Enabling other teams to leverage the tools and methodologies to perform in-depth power analysis. Education requirements: • Required: Bachelor's/master’s Computer Engineering and/or Electrical Engineering • Preferred: Masters
